Timex Group acquires Indian retailer Just Watches

(Source: Just Watches)

US watchmaker Timex Group has acquired Indian premium timepiece label Just Watches from Priority Marketing for an undisclosed sum. 

Under the agreement, Timex India will take over all the physical stores of Just Watches and its e-commerce site. The company said the acquisition will help establish a deeper direct connection and support them in their online purchase process. 

“This is in line with our future growth plans and hence brings a perfect synergy between the coming together of the two brands,” said Deepak Chhabra, MD at Timex India. “Through this business move, at Timex, we are geared up to increase our consumer base countrywide.”

Founded by Shailesh and Manisha Sangani in 2009 with the first store opened in New Delhi, Just Watches retails some 40 brands across more than 70 physical stores, according to the brand website. 

Timex India has more than 35 exclusive franchised stores under the name Timex World. The company recently sponsored IPL defending Champion, The Gujarat Titans team. 

Timex Group operates through more than 5000 offline trade stores and key online portals, producing watches under several global brands, including Guess, Versace, Nautica, Furla and Ted Baker.
